Recently reported ENGINE problems on 2014 Maserati Ghibli

Early ghiblis are known to have an issue with the connection of the turbo waste gate actuator to the waste gate. there has been a recall campaign to add a clip to these cars to quiet rattling on that joint. my car had the recall performed, and subsequently began rattling again. i reported this to my service center and was told that the rattle i was hearing was normal, all ghiblis do it. several months passed and the rattle got worse, so i took the car to an independent mechanic who told me that not only are the clips to prevent rattling missing, but the c clips that hold the actuator on to the waste gate are missing. this is apparently a well-known issue to maserati that can result in engine damage if the waste gates fail to open, maserati refuses to admit that this is a faulty deign and repair the vehicle, and as i am out of warranty wants to charge me nearly $10,000 to replace both turbos.
